[08/15] Remove tui_alloc_source_buffer

  There is no longer any need for tui_alloc_source_buffer.  The two
callers of this function immediately change the contents of the
window, undoing the work done by this function.

This required adding a move constructor to tui_source_element -- a
mildly surprising find, but without this, resizing the vector will
cause crashes.  This issue was masked earlier because
tui_alloc_source_buffer handled this.

diff --git a/gdb/tui/tui-winsource.h b/gdb/tui/tui-winsource.h
index f88f6b7de45..320c8370166 100644
--- a/gdb/tui/tui-winsource.h
+++ b/gdb/tui/tui-winsource.h
@@ -69,6 +69,17 @@  struct tui_source_element
     xfree (line);
   }
 
+  DISABLE_COPY_AND_ASSIGN (tui_source_element);
+
+  tui_source_element (tui_source_element &&other)
+    : line (other.line),
+      line_or_addr (other.line_or_addr),
+      is_exec_point (other.is_exec_point),
+      break_mode (other.break_mode)
+  {
+    other.line = nullptr;
+  }
+
   char *line = nullptr;
   struct tui_line_or_address line_or_addr;
   bool is_exec_point = false;
